For six months, I led with “AI-powered solutions.” The response? Crickets. Or worse,
skepticism. People had heard it all before. Revolutionary. Transformative. Groundbreaking.
All buzzwords, no substance.

Then I made one change. I stopped talking about the tools. I started talking about
the results. Everything shifted.

The short version: People don’t want drills. They want holes.
I was selling drills.

The Pivot

I run a studio now. Not an AI consultancy. Not a tech agency. A studio. What does
that mean? It means we create things. We build. We craft. The tools are irrelevant—
paintbrush, chisel, code, AI model. What matters is what we make with them.

When I started positioning DRiPGATE as a studio for artists, messengers, and edge-dwellers,
the right people found us. Not the ones looking for a quick AI fix. The ones looking
for partners who understand that tools are just tools. The ones who care about the art,
the message, the outcome.

Why “Studio” Changes Everything

A consultant sells time. An agency sells services. A studio sells vision. When you
walk into a recording studio, you’re not buying microphones. You’re buying the producer’s
ear. The engineer’s expertise. The space where something great might happen.

The difference: A consultant asks “what problem do you need solved?”
A studio asks “what do you want to create?” One fixes. The other transforms.

The Philosophy

This is what 30 years in technology has taught me: the tools change constantly. The
principles don’t. Clear thinking. Good taste. Understanding people. These are timeless.
These are what matter.

AI is the most significant shift I’ve seen since the web. It will change everything.
But it won’t replace judgment. It won’t replace taste. It won’t replace the human
ability to understand what resonates with other humans.

The tools don’t matter. The outcome does. That’s the studio mindset. And it’s
changed everything about how we work.
